Day 1: Monterosso al Mare
Once you arrive at Milan airport, a private driver will be there to welcome you and take you directly to the Cinque Terre. The car ride takes about 2 and a half hours, but the journey is enjoyable, with changing landscapes as you get closer to Liguria.
The tour will begin in Monterosso al Mare, the largest village of the Cinque Terre, where your private guide will greet you. This is the perfect moment to start soaking in the unique atmosphere of these places. Begin your exploration with a walk along the seafront, perhaps stopping to admire Fegina Beach, one of the most beautiful in the area, famous for its golden sand. Your guide will tell you the history of the village, take you to discover the Capuchin Convent, which offers a breathtaking view of the coast, and lead you through the charming narrow streets of the historic center.
For lunch, you can choose one of the seaside restaurants to taste local specialties like trofie with pesto or a delicious plate of fresh seafood. After your meal, you'll have some time to enjoy the landscape, relax, and immerse yourself in the atmosphere of Monterosso.
The rest of the evening and dinner are free.

Day 2: Vernazza, Corniglia e Manarola
The second day begins with a leisurely breakfast, followed by a journey to explore the other villages of the Cinque Terre. Your guide will accompany you by train, a convenient and quick way to travel between the villages. The first stop of the day is Vernazza, one of the most iconic villages. Here, you’ll stroll along the small harbor and hike up to the Doria Castle to enjoy a spectacular view of the entire coastline. Your guide will share fascinating facts and stories about life in this village. Don’t forget to stop at one of the local cafes for an aperitif with a sea view.

After a walk around the village, it will be time to have lunch at one of Vernazza's typical restaurants, where you can enjoy a meal of Ligurian focaccia and fresh seafood.

In the afternoon, you’ll continue on to Corniglia, a village perched atop a hill with an incredible view of the vineyards and the sea below. Your guide will take you for a leisurely stroll through the town center, where you can also stop for a panoramic photo.

From Corniglia, you’ll take the train to Manarola, another gem of the Cinque Terre. You’ll walk along the small harbor and head toward the panoramic viewpoint to admire the colorful houses overlooking the sea. This is the perfect moment to snap some unforgettable photos.

At the end of the tour, you’ll return to your hotel in Monterosso al Mare.

The rest of the evening and dinner are free.

Day 3: Riomaggiore
On the third day, after breakfast and check-out, your guide will take you to Riomaggiore, the last of the Cinque Terre villages. Here, you’ll visit the Riomaggiore Castle, located on a hill, offering a spectacular view of the town and the sea. After the visit, take a walk through the narrow streets of the village, where you can savor the true essence of Ligurian life. If you enjoy shopping, you can stop by some local craft shops to take home a small souvenir.

For lunch, you can choose one of the local restaurants, where you can savor fresh dishes like fried fish or risotto prepared with the freshest local ingredients.

In the afternoon, you can choose to hike the Cinque Terre’s natural trails or simply relax on Riomaggiore’s beach. If you enjoy walking, the guide will suggest some panoramic routes that will offer unforgettable views.

Finally, it will be time to say goodbye to the Cinque Terre and head back to Milan. Your guide and private driver will accompany you to the car for the transfer to Milan’s airport. The journey will take about 2 and a half hours, allowing for one last scenic stop before arriving at the airport.
